What is the Synthes Infrapatellar Tibial Nail?**
First things first, what exactly is the Synthes Infrapatellar Tibial Nail? In simple terms, it's a metal rod that surgeons insert into your tibia to stabilize and heal a fracture. Think of it like an internal splint. The "infrapatellar" part refers to the location where the nail is inserted, just below the kneecap (patella). This approach is often favored because it can be less invasive than other methods, and it allows for a quicker recovery in many cases. The Synthes Infrapatellar Tibial Nail is a specific product, made by Synthes, a well-known company in the orthopedic industry (now part of DePuy Synthes). These nails come in various sizes and designs to accommodate different types of fractures and patient anatomies. They're typically made of titanium or a similar biocompatible metal, which means your body is less likely to reject it. This is super important because you want the nail to stay put and do its job without causing any problems. The nail itself is hollow, which makes it strong yet lightweight, and it often has interlocking screws that lock the nail in place within the bone fragments. This locking mechanism is key to providing the stability needed for the bone to heal correctly. The goal is to get you back on your feet (literally!) as quickly and safely as possible. Think of the nail as a bridge, holding the broken pieces together until your bone can mend itself. Surgeons carefully choose the right nail size and configuration based on the specifics of your fracture and your individual bone structure. The Surgical Procedure Explained
Alright, let's talk about the surgical process. If you're facing a surgery involving the Synthes Infrapatellar Tibial Nail, understanding what to expect can ease a lot of anxiety. Before the surgery, your surgeon will do a thorough examination, including X-rays and possibly other imaging scans (like a CT scan), to assess the fracture and plan the surgery. They'll also discuss your medical history and any medications you're taking. On the day of the surgery, you'll be given anesthesia – either general anesthesia, which puts you completely to sleep, or regional anesthesia, which numbs your leg. Once you're under anesthesia, the surgeon will make a small incision just below your kneecap. The incision's size is typically designed to minimize tissue damage. Using specialized instruments, the surgeon will carefully prepare the medullary canal (the hollow space inside your tibia) to receive the nail. This might involve reaming, which is a process of widening the canal to accommodate the nail. The Synthes Infrapatellar Tibial Nail is then inserted into the canal. The surgeon will use imaging, such as fluoroscopy (real-time X-ray), to ensure the nail is correctly positioned and that the fracture is properly aligned. Once the nail is in place, interlocking screws are inserted through the nail and into the bone fragments. These screws lock the nail, providing stability and preventing rotation or shifting of the fracture site. The screws are the key to keeping everything in place! After the nail and screws are secured, the incision is closed, and a dressing is applied. The entire procedure usually takes a couple of hours, depending on the complexity of the fracture. Afterward, you'll be moved to a recovery room, where your vital signs will be monitored. You'll likely have some pain and discomfort, which will be managed with pain medication. Post-Surgery Recovery and Rehabilitation
So, you've had the surgery – now what? The recovery and rehabilitation phase after getting the Synthes Infrapatellar Tibial Nail are just as important as the surgery itself. In the immediate post-operative period, expect some pain and swelling. Your medical team will provide you with pain medication to keep you comfortable. You'll likely be instructed to keep your leg elevated to reduce swelling. Rest is essential during this phase, but you'll also be encouraged to do gentle exercises to maintain circulation and prevent stiffness. Your physical therapist will be your best friend during recovery. They'll guide you through specific exercises designed to restore your range of motion, strength, and balance. These exercises will gradually become more challenging as you progress. Weight-bearing is a key aspect of recovery. Depending on your fracture and the surgeon's recommendations, you may be allowed to start putting some weight on your leg relatively soon after surgery. This is usually done with the assistance of crutches or a walker. The physical therapist will teach you how to walk with these assistive devices. As your bone heals, you'll gradually increase the amount of weight you put on your leg. This is a progressive process, so don't rush it! Follow your physical therapist's instructions closely. The rehabilitation process also includes exercises to strengthen the muscles around your knee and ankle. Strengthening these muscles is crucial for supporting your leg and preventing re-injury. You'll also work on improving your balance and coordination. The recovery timeline varies from person to person, but typically, it takes several months to fully recover. Patience and consistency with your physical therapy are key. Regular follow-up appointments with your surgeon are also important. They'll monitor your progress, take X-rays to check on bone healing, and adjust your treatment plan as needed. Don't hesitate to ask your medical team any questions or voice any concerns you have. Potential Risks and Complications
While the Synthes Infrapatellar Tibial Nail is a highly effective treatment, it's essential to be aware of the potential risks and complications. No surgery is without risk, and it's always wise to be informed. One potential risk is infection. Although the risk is relatively low, it's still a possibility. Surgeons take strict precautions to minimize the risk of infection, but if it occurs, it may require antibiotics or further surgery to remove the nail. Another possible complication is nonunion or delayed union. This means that the fracture either doesn't heal at all or takes longer than expected to heal. Factors like smoking, poor nutrition, and certain medical conditions can increase the risk of this. Malunion is another risk, where the bone heals in a misaligned position. This can lead to problems with walking and may require further intervention. Hardware failure, such as the nail or screws breaking or loosening, is also a possibility, though it's relatively rare. Nerve damage is another potential complication. Nerves can be injured during surgery, leading to numbness, tingling, or weakness in the leg. Blood clots are a serious risk associated with any surgery, including this one. Blood clots can travel to the lungs and cause a pulmonary embolism, which can be life-threatening. Deep vein thrombosis (DVT) is also a potential complication. Your medical team will take steps to prevent blood clots, such as prescribing blood thinners and encouraging you to move your leg. Complex regional pain syndrome (CRPS) is a rare but serious condition that can occur after surgery. It causes chronic pain, swelling, and changes in skin temperature and color.
